Ringle wrote the 1998 book “Life in Mr. Lincoln’s Navy.” The 240-page work is about shipboard life in the Civil War.

The Civilian Health and Medical Program of the Department of Veterans Affairs (CHAMPVA) is a health insurance program in which VA pays part of the cost of certain health care services and supplies.
